Does Radiant Performer work with auras?

Asked by Madcookie 4 years ago

I wonder if Radiant Performer works with auras's enchant ability such as

1 - Captured by the Consulate to neuter all opponent's creatures and protect my own

2 - Confiscate to gain control of every permanent

3 - Paradox Haze to enchant everyone and give them extra upkeeps

Raging_Squiggle says... Accepted answer #1

Yes this is one of the few cards that can do this with spells besides instants and sorceries.

Casting an aura spell intrinsically targets something, whether be a creature you don’t control, a permanent, or whatever.

Radiant Performer will copy any aura spell that targets a single target, creating a copy of said aura for any and all applicable targets.

Polaris says... #2

To be clear, this works because Enchant is a keyword that means "this spell enters the battlefield attached to target object," which is why an Aura is a targeted spell. When a copy of a permanent spell resolves, it creates a token that's a copy of the original card, so you'll create token Auras attached to the available targets.

Specifically, it’s because of this rule:

303.4a An Aura spell requires a target, which is defined by its enchant ability.

It’ll create token auras on the stack each targeting every other object that enchantment could target. They’ll resolve one at a time, each entering the battlefield attached to their respective targets
